Wisbrod Holds on to Double Thru Tulin

Level 15 : Blinds 3,000/6,000, 6,000 ante

Barak Wisbrod and Nikolai Tulin were heads-up on a flop of {9-Hearts}{6-Spades}{8-Hearts} when Wisbrod got his last 161,000 in the middle.

Barak Wisbrod: {9-Clubs}{9-Diamonds}
Nikolai Tulin: {q-Hearts}{10-Hearts}

Wisbrod had flopped a set of nines but didn't to hold against Tulin's flush and straight draws. Tulin stood up from his seat to await the board as the dealer turned over the {2-Diamonds}, followed by the {k-Clubs}.

Tulin let out an anguished cry as he missed his draws and handed over the double up to Wisbrod.
